FORDYCE CONCRETE, INC. v. MACK TRUCKS, INC.

Civ. A. No. 81-2041.

535 F.Supp. 118 (1982)

FORDYCE CONCRETE, INC., Plaintiff, v. MACK TRUCKS, INC., et al., Defendants.

United States District Court, D. Kansas.

March 17, 1982.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Dennis L. Horner and Martha Ridgway Schmid of the firm of Horner, Duckers & Cornwell, Kansas City, Kan., for plaintiff.

Edmund S. Gross of the firm of Weeks, Thomas & Lysaught, Kansas City, Kan., for defendant Mack Trucks, Inc.

Charles A. Getto of the firm of McAnany, Van Cleave & Phillips, Kansas City, Kan., for defendant Reynolds Metals Co.


MEMORANDUM AND ORDER

EARL E. O'CONNOR, Chief Judge.

Defendant Mack Truck, Inc., and defendant Reynolds Metals Company have filed respective motions for summary judgment on the grounds (1) that plaintiff's warranty claim is barred by the four-year statute of limitations pursuant to K.S.A. 84-2-725, and (2) that the damages suffered by plaintiff were solely economic loss and cannot support a strict liability claim...
